Output 107e77aa664d4df592acf2ba88163a6768b276989999660875ea584cb17e58eb:34

value
964846050
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 45b78b709b802d92a10fba2097da53140a594b70 OP_EQUALVERIFY OP_CHECKSIG
address
LRaamMhgkKWYMSZjsudntxYjsXojiZzTg2
transaction
107e77aa664d4df592acf2ba88163a6768b276989999660875ea584cb17e58eb
spent
true